1995 Cadillac Seville vs. 2004 Opel Astra

To start off, 2004 Opel Astra is newer by 9 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1995 Cadillac Seville.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1995 Cadillac Seville would be higher. At 4,563 cc (8 cylinders), 1995 Cadillac Seville is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1995 Cadillac Seville (300 HP @ 6000 RPM) has 197 more horse power than 2004 Opel Astra. (103 HP @ 6000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1995 Cadillac Seville should accelerate faster than 2004 Opel Astra.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1995 Cadillac Seville weights approximately 389 kg more than 2004 Opel Astra.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.

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1995 Cadillac Seville (400 Nm @ 4400 RPM) has 250 more torque (in Nm) than 2004 Opel Astra. (150 Nm @ 3900 RPM). This means 1995 Cadillac Seville will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2004 Opel Astra. 1995 Cadillac Seville has automatic transmission and 2004 Opel Astra has manual transmission. 2004 Opel Astra will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 1995 Cadillac Seville will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.

Compare all specifications:

1995 Cadillac Seville 2004 Opel Astra
Make Cadillac Opel
Model Seville Astra
Year Released 1995 2004
Body Type Sedan Station Wagon
Engine Position Front Front
Engine Size 4563 cc 1598 cc
Engine Cylinders 8 cylinders 4 cylinders
Engine Type V in-line
Horse Power 300 HP 103 HP
Engine RPM 6000 RPM 6000 RPM
Torque 400 Nm 150 Nm
Torque RPM 4400 RPM 3900 RPM
Engine Bore Size 93 mm 79 mm
Engine Stroke Size 84 mm 81.5 mm
Engine Compression Ratio 10.3:1 10.5:1
Top Speed 241 km/hour 185 km/hour
Drive Type Front Front
Transmission Type Automatic Manual
Number of Seats 5 seats 5 seats
Number of Doors 4 doors 5 doors
Vehicle Weight 1764 kg 1375 kg
Vehicle Length 5190 mm 4290 mm
Vehicle Width 1890 mm 1720 mm
Vehicle Height 1390 mm 1470 mm
Wheelbase Size 2830 mm 2700 mm
Fuel Tank Capacity 75 L 52 L
